Tex. Finance Code § 353.202: CREDIT LIFE AND CREDIT HEALTH AND ACCIDENT INSURANCE.

(a) A holder may require a retail buyer to provide credit life insurance and credit health and accident insurance.
(b) The holder may offer to provide credit life insurance and credit health and accident insurance, regardless of whether the holder requires a retail buyer to provide the insurance under Subsection (a).
(c) A retail seller may offer involuntary unemployment insurance to the buyer at the time the contract is negotiated or executed.
(d) A holder may include the cost of insurance provided under this section, and a policy or agent fee charged in connection with insurance provided under Subsection (b) or (c), as a separate charge in the contract.
Added by Acts 2011, 82nd Leg., R.S., Ch. 117 (H.B. 2559), Sec. 17, eff. September 1, 2011.
